Speaker Profiles:
Simon Headaux, Director, ReThink Productivity
Simon’s practical know-how and hard headed entrepreneurial approach to business brings a unique perspective to optimising operating costs.
Combining over 50 years of cumulative experience working for some of the largest brands in many industries and sectors, such as Vodafone, Boots, Siemens and Costa Coffee, ReThink understand how businesses can boost their productivity. They are a full service, productivity consultancy that help businesses implement changes in their business and produce productivity roadmaps and associated project plans, including workload models, role studies and organisational design, time and motion studies, efficiency reviews and benchmarking.
Mark Peacock, Director, Price Maker Ltd
After a 25-year career in the corporate world, in positions that include Head of AA & BSM Driving Schools and Chair of the Pricing Steering Committee at DHL Express, pricing had always played an important part Mark’s previous roles, and he knew how much of an impact it could have on any business. Mark spotted there was a gap in the market for pricing advice for SMEs, and founded PriceMaker to deliver on that vision of helping SMEs become price makers, rather price takers. By using smarter pricing, they help businesses differentiate themselves from the competition, and achieve better prices in a way that their customers will value. Their vision is to inspire and transform businesses to become more successful by using the power of pricing to maximise profits.
Eligibility:
This workshop is open to eligible high growth businesses located in Derby, Derbyshire, Nottingham and Nottinghamshire that can demonstrate 20% annual growth in revenue, employment, or market share over the past three consecutive years.
You must be registered on the High Growth Accelerator project.
Receipt of this support is subject to the Subsidy Control Act (2022). To qualify an enterprise cannot have received more than £315,000 Minimal Financial Assistance (MFA) and or De Minimis within any three-year period.
The project is funded by the UK Government through the UK Shared Prosperity Fund.
